The IASSC Certified Lean Six Sigma Green Belt™ (ICGB™) is a professional who is well versed in the core of advanced elements of Lean Six Sigma Methodology.
Professional who leads improvement projects and serves as a team member as a part of more complex improvement projects lead by a Certified Black Belt, typically in a part-time role.
A Lean Six Sigma Green Belt possesses a thorough understanding of all aspects of the Lean Six Sigma Method including competence in subject matters contained within the phases of Define, Measure, Analyze, Improve and Control (DMAIC) as defined by the IASSC Lean Six Sigma Green Belt Body of Knowledge™.
A Lean Six Sigma Green Belt understands how to implement, perform, interpret and apply Lean Six Sigma at a high level of proficiency.

Exam Information
The IASSC Certified Lean Six Sigma Green Belt Exam™ is a 100 question, closed book, proctored exam with a 3 hour allotted time.
The Exam contains approximately 20 multiple-choice and true/false questions from each primary section of the IASSC Lean Six Sigma Green Belt Body of Knowledge through the IASSC Web-Based On-Demand testing system.
Requirements
There are no prerequisites required to sit for the IASSC Certified Lean Six Sigma Green Belt Exam.
Certification
Upon achievement, Professionals will receive IASSC Green Belt Certification issued by the International Association for Six Sigma Certification™, the only independent third-party Certification Association within the Lean Six Sigma Industry.
IASSC Certification is recognized perpetually and with a validity for three years.
